THE STRATEGY

Only 41 Senators are needed to vote against the approaching vote for cloture.

IF 41 Senators vote against cloture, THEN:

Harry Reid must decide EITHER

1. To allow a vote on the CR WITH DEFUNDING Obamacare language as-is OR

2. Not allow a vote on the original CR.

In either case as expected the government will be unfunded and will shutdown but the blame will be on the Senate. This is the strategy.

What is doomed to failure is the Senate democrats passing the original CR. But then they and they alone are responsible for shutting down the government as the original CR funds all of government except Obamacare.

The way the Senate democrats escape responsibility unscathed is to pass a vote for cloture, strip out the defunding language and send it back to the House. Even in this eventuality the House republicans can still win by passing smaller funding CRs for essential spending and denying an increase in the debt ceiling.
